Midterm Elections Highlight Disparities in Obamacare Enrollment Efforts

As midterm elections draw near, the Department of Health and Human Services encounters challenges with lower-than-expected Obamacare signups, leading to tensions with states.

Editorial StaffMay 25, 20261 min read

The upcoming midterm elections are casting a shadow over healthcare policy discussions, particularly concerning the Affordable Care Act.

The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) has reported a disappointing number of signups for Obamacare, which has raised concerns among policymakers.

States are expressing disagreement with federal evaluations of the enrollment situation, indicating a potential rift in the approach to healthcare access.
